What does Fuse Medical do? Fuse Medical Inc. is a US-based company specializing in the distribution of orthopedic implants and blood circulation products. Founded in 2014, the company is headquartered in Richardson, Texas. The business model of Fuse Medical is based on the distribution of orthopedic implants, consumables, and instruments to medical practices, hospitals, and surgical facilities. The company works closely with leading manufacturers to offer its customers a wide range of high-quality products. Fuse Medical's product range includes primary and revision implants for various areas such as hips, knees, shoulders, and the spine. In addition, Fuse Medical also offers a wide range of instruments to meet the needs of its customers. These products are supplied by a variety of manufacturers from around the world, allowing Fuse Medical to meet the needs of its customers. In recent years, Fuse Medical has also focused on the distribution of blood circulation products, including non-invasive devices to improve circulation and devices for the treatment of wound healing disorders.
